Ann Widdecombe, a former Conservative MP and Brexit Party MEP, dives into the failures of Britain's political elite and the erosion of traditional conservative values. She critiques mass immigration and net zero policies while emphasizing the urgent need for political reform. Widdecombe also addresses the disconnect between Westminster and the public, the rise of Reform UK, and the troubling state of free speech in Britain. With a bold perspective, she argues for a reclamation of personal freedoms and accountability within the political system.

INSIGHT

The Progressive Consensus Problem

  • British politics suffers from a "progressive consensus" with major parties occupying similar middle ground.
  • This lack of serious ideological difference removes real choice and political enthusiasm for voters.
INSIGHT

Preparing Reform for Government

  • Reform UK must build comprehensive policy documents in the next four years to prepare for governance.
  • Election success boosts donor interest, essential for funding political operations.
ADVICE

Candidate Selection Focus

  • Select parliamentary candidates with proven real-world achievements to strengthen governance.
  • Prioritize business, farming, and legal experience over identity politics and quotas.
